[SCSI] iscsi: fix up iscsi printk prefix

Some iscsi class messages have the dev_printk prefix and some libiscsi
and iscsi_tcp messages have "iscsi" or the module name as a prefix which
is normally pretty useless when trying to figure out which session
or connection the message is attached to. This patch adds iscsi lib
and class dev_printks so all messages have a common prefix that
can be used to figure out which object printed it.
